UAS regulatory sequences drive expression of a short inverted repeat.
Expression of Abca3HMS01796 under the control of Scer\GAL4elav.PLu leads to an increase in the active zone density at neuromuscular junctions (of muscle 4 of the A3 and A4 segment) in third instar larvae when compared to controls.
Expression of ABCAHMS01796 under the control of either Scer\GAL4GR1 or Scer\GAL4nos.UTR.T:Hsim\VP16 does not induce any nurse cell clearance defect in mutant stage 14 egg chambers and like in wild-type all the germ-line derived nurse cells have undergone programmed cell death and been cleared by this stage.
Expression from one copy of ABCAHMS01796 under the control of Scer\GAL4elav.PLu leads to a significant increase in average distance between male adults (not between female adults), despite no significant changes in locomotor ability, as compared to controls. Reared under 12h:12h light:dark cycles, these adults present mild increases in evening peak activity (including an early onset of activity), and in midday siesta activity, but not in morning activity peak, and a mild decrease in night time sleep, as compared to controls.
The neuromuscular junctions of third instar larvae expressing from one copy of ABCAHMS01796 under the control of Scer\GAL4elav.PLu exhibit a small but significant increase in the number of satellite boutons, but exhibit no obvious changes in the number of mature boutons, or in either the number or length of branches, as compared to controls.
